Anthony Davis: The Basics

Before we jump into the nitty-gritty stats, let's cover the basics. Anthony Davis, nicknamed "AD" or "The Brow," is a professional basketball player currently playing for the Los Angeles Lakers. He was drafted first overall in the 2012 NBA draft by the New Orleans Hornets (now Pelicans). Known for his incredible versatility, Davis can dominate both offensively and defensively. He's a walking double-double, a shot-blocking machine, and a scoring threat from anywhere on the court. He stands tall at 6'10" and possesses a rare combination of size, athleticism, and skill that makes him a nightmare matchup for opponents. Regular Season Stats: A Consistent Force

When we talk about Anthony Davis's regular season stats, consistency is the name of the game. Throughout his career, he has consistently averaged high numbers in points, rebounds, blocks, and steals. Let's break it down. He boasts a career average of around 24 points per game, showcasing his scoring prowess. His rebounding numbers are equally impressive, averaging around 10 rebounds per game. Defensively, he's a beast, averaging over 2 blocks per game for his career. But it's not just the raw numbers that tell the story. It's the efficiency with which he achieves them. Davis boasts a high field goal percentage, often shooting above 50% from the field. This speaks to his shot selection and his ability to score in a variety of ways, whether it's posting up, driving to the basket, or hitting mid-range jumpers. Furthermore, his impact extends beyond scoring and rebounding. He also averages over a steal per game, demonstrating his active hands and ability to disrupt opposing offenses. Season-by-Season Breakdown

Let's break down Anthony Davis's stats season by season to really understand his growth and impact. Starting with his rookie season in New Orleans, he showed flashes of brilliance, averaging around 13 points and 8 rebounds per game. As he matured, his numbers steadily increased. By his third season, he was already averaging over 24 points and 10 rebounds, establishing himself as a bonafide star. His time with the Pelicans was marked by individual brilliance, but team success was often elusive. Then came the trade to the Lakers, where he joined forces with LeBron James. This partnership immediately paid dividends, as the Lakers won the championship in their first season together. Davis's stats remained consistently high, and his impact on both ends of the floor was undeniable. Even through injuries and team changes, his individual performance has remained at an elite level. Advanced Stats: Beyond the Box Score

Now, let's get into some advanced stats for Anthony Davis. These metrics go beyond the traditional box score and offer a deeper understanding of his impact. We're talking about things like Player Efficiency Rating (PER), Win Shares, and Box Plus/Minus (BPM). Davis consistently ranks high in PER, which measures a player's per-minute production. His Win Shares, which estimates the number of wins contributed by a player, are also consistently impressive. BPM, which estimates a player's contribution to the team per 100 possessions, further underscores his all-around impact. But perhaps the most telling advanced stat is his Defensive Box Plus/Minus (DBPM), which highlights his defensive prowess. Davis consistently ranks among the league leaders in DBPM, showcasing his ability to disrupt opposing offenses and protect the rim.
